博客
关于我
强烈建议你试试无所不能的chatGPT,快点击我
整理装饰器的形成过程,背诵装饰器的固定格式
阅读量:5151 次
发布时间:2019-06-13

本文共 477 字,大约阅读时间需要 1 分钟。

固定格式def wrapper(func): 2.传入函数值f    def inner(*args, **kwargs):        #执行函数前进行的操作        ret = func(*args,**kwargs)  # 5.执行f()函数        #执行函数后进行的操作        return ret   # 6.返回一个值给函数调用者  inner函数名的id    return inner   # 4.通过return把返回值给函数调用者  此时f = inner@wrapper  # 1.f = wrapper(f)执行wrapper函数def f():    print(666)f() 3.执行inner函数 f() = inner()注意:return用法 1.函数遇到return时函数体结束2.如果return后面跟上函数名则返回函数名在内存中的id3.如果return后面跟上其他字符则返回其本身

转载于:https://www.cnblogs.com/dragonff/p/10119602.html

你可能感兴趣的文章
分页查询
查看>>
5.水果
查看>>
php防止刷点击数的方法
查看>>
java如何判断字符串是否为空(小知识)
查看>>
HBase性能优化方法总结(三):读表操作(转)
查看>>
Pytorch系列教程-使用字符级RNN对姓名进行分类
查看>>
博客园添加访问人数统计(转)
查看>>
Ztree 随笔记
查看>>
2018/12/21 HDU-2077 汉诺塔IV(递归)
查看>>
dfs/bfs(转载)
查看>>
小生功能贴<一> --- 动态添加应用 具有长按删除功能
查看>>
【Apach shiro】spring 整合Apache shiro
查看>>
java获取当前上一周、上一月、上一年的时间
查看>>
图片代替滚动条 JS文件2
查看>>
HTML 学习笔记
查看>>
多项目上传文件解决方案之:Flash上传插件
查看>>
Linux相关学习笔记-文件系统
查看>>
《linux 内核全然剖析》sched.c sched.h 代码分析笔记
查看>>
Android学习之——优化篇(2)
查看>>
好的开源库总结
查看>>